Very similar to a problem I'm experiencing with my Samba server, also running 64-bit 8.10. My error message is:
kernel: [3990168.499988] BUG: soft lockup - CPU#0 stuck for 61s! [kswapd0:188] This has happened twice, both times preceded by more than 1 month of up time. System is a Dell Vostro 410N (dual-core Intel). The first time the problems occurred more or less at the same time the system was backing up (using rdiff-backup) to an attach USB drive. The second time occurred while the system was transferring files via rsync to another server. So in both cases there was an additional process doing I/O while the Samba server was running (usually Samba is the only service the system runs). -- Ubuntu Intrepid BUG: soft lockup - CPU#0 stuck for 61s!
